VA-11: Early Voting Dates In Fairfax City For Congressional Special Election
FAIRFAX CITY, VA Early in-person voting for the Sept. 9 special election to fill the vacant 11th Congressional District seat in Virginia begins on Friday, July 25. Voters will choose which candidate will succeed former U.S. Rep. Gerry Connolly (D).
Last November, Connolly revealed that he'd been diagnosed with esophageal cancer and was receiving chemotherapy and immunotherapy treatment. However, the cancer returned and the congressman's family announced he had died on May 21.
Two candidates are on the special election ballot: Braddock District Supervisor James Walkinshaw (D) and Stewart Whitson (R), the senior director of federal affairs at the Foundation of Government Accountability, a conservative think tank. Both candidates earned their spot on the ballot by winning the June 28 primaries of their respective political parties.
